Na2 Zr1 Cu2 S4
semiconductor· Na2 Zr1 Cu2 S4
Na2Zr1Cu2S4 is an experimental quaternary sulfide semiconductor compound combining sodium, zirconium, and copper in a sulfide matrix. This material belongs to the family of transition metal sulfides, which are under active research for photovoltaic, thermoelectric, and ionic conductor applications due to their tunable bandgaps and mixed-valence chemistry. While not yet commercialized at scale, such copper-zirconium sulfides are investigated as alternatives to conventional semiconductors for energy conversion and solid-state battery electrolytes, where their combined chemical constituents offer potential advantages in stability, cost, and ion transport compared to oxide-based or purely organic counterparts.
